AVOIDING THE deaths of 2,700 people on the Portuguese roads by 2015 is the goal of the National Road Safety Strategy (ENSR), as revealed in a presentation in Faro on May 27.
The final document for road safety plans is still being drafted but follows other documents and plans that have already led to a reduction in road accidents by 54.5 per cent in the past seven years.
